Abstract: Over the years, research has suggested how the transition into motherhood is a crucial period in which the new mother faces a number of conflicting challenges. The aim of this qualitative study is to explore the lived experience of first-time mothers as it relates to their psychological well-being in nurturing their infant. Research pertaining to the local field is scant. Therefore, this research study aims to provide an insight into the raw, novel world of motherhood as experienced by first-time Maltese mothers. Data was collected from six participants through semi-structured interviews. Having assayed the gathered experiences through Interpretative Phenomenological Analysis (IPA), findings have highlighted the saliency of factors which contribute to the psychological well-being of the first-time mother, including support, maternal self-efficacy, attachment and breastfeeding, and post-partum depression (PPD) amongst others.
